Wow, that's one of the highest mileage Supras I personally heard of.
Other than basic and planned maintenance, how has reliability been overall?
Only needed basic and planned maintenance so far. Absolutely no issues at all in the entire 60k miles driven. Most of the maintenance I did myself as well so tbh this car has been extremely cheap to own. Even took it on a cross country trip going 75mph for 4-6 hour stretches and still had no issues then or now.

Currently my Supra is my daily, but not my only car. I own a 2016 VW Tiguan 4- motion that my wife dailys and we share when it's snowing or flooding and I have to go into the office. I also own a 2007 Cayman that's slowly being built into a caged, pilow-balled, track-only "beater".

The Supra is a great daily driver, even on snowy roads (with good tires). The fuel economy is acceptable, and it's a comfortable car. I have driven mine through 2X New England winters now and I haven't seen a spec of rust. I just don't want to keep putting the miles on the car.

Looking to find a decent daily now, but the interest rates are just so awful. I need something that's great in the snow and gets greater than 25 MPG. Looking at a lightly used GTI or another Volvo...maybe a GR Corolla since they're actually in stock at some of the dealerships near me.
